Abstract
We investigate the two main uncertainties on the extraction of the nonperturbative matrix elements and from moments of the inclusive rare FCNC decay The first one is due to unknown matrix elements of higher dimensional operators which are estimated by varying the matrix elements in a range as suggested by dimensional analysis. The effect of these terms is found to be small. A second uncertainty arises from a cut on the photon energy and we give model independent bounds on these uncertainties as well as their estimates from a simplified version of the ACCMM model.
